Texas Education Code Chapter 25: Admission, Transfer and Attendance. Age at Which School Attendance is Required. Unless an exception applies, students between ages six and eighteen are required to attend school in Texas. Exceptions to Attendance Requirements. In 1891, the Free Education Act provided for the state payment of school fees up to ten shillings per week. This was to help poor children attend school. By 1893 the school leaving age was raised to 11 and schools were established for the deaf and blind. The age was later raised ...

Your child must start complying with Iowa’s compulsory school law if he or she is (or will be) 6 by September 15 of the school year. If a 5-year-old is enrolled in public school, he becomes subject to compulsory attendance immediately unless the parents notify the school district in writing of their intent to remove the child ... ….

15.12.2020 17:46 • Updated 16.12.2020 11:43. Parliament has approved a proposal to extend the age of compulsory schooling in Finland to 18. At the same time, MPs voted to make secondary education entirely free of charge — meaning students will in future not have to provide their own textbooks. Primary and secondary school are compulsory between the ages of 6 and 16. School education is for 13 years, divided into: primary school for 7 or 8 years, from kindergarten or preschool to year 6 or 7. secondary school for 3 to 4 years - years 7 to 10 or years 8 to 10.
